Output 93377339cb5e90ddf25e74bf3c806106ea7edb0dd6d149afaebf25bf1a7956ab:0

value
450410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a3d552b624f2b20b57071a707f72b0c1e418644 OP_EQUAL
address
3HDAGdDHrUWRF2PAMZjYPZCGeUjMmXV2zs
transaction
93377339cb5e90ddf25e74bf3c806106ea7edb0dd6d149afaebf25bf1a7956ab
spent
true